The median household income in Mossville, IL is N/A. Per capita income is $23,132. The poverty rate of 4.3% is lower than the IL state average of 12.0%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.2975,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 15.3%, compared to the state average of 5.6%. 30.9%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 16 minutes, with 0.0% working from home.
